Tips on Weight-Loss Programs
If you join a weight-loss program, pick one that encourages healthy weight-loss behaviors that you can continue. Safe and effective weight-loss programs should include:
- Healthy eating plans that reduce calories but do not rule out specific foods or food groups
- Instruction on physical activity and/or exercise
- Tips on healthy behavior changes that also consider your cultural needs
- Slow and steady weight loss of about 3/4 to 2 pounds per week and not more than 3 pounds per week (weight loss may be faster at the start of a program)
- Medical care if you are planning to lose weight by following a special formula diet, such as a very-low-calorie diet
- A plan to keep the weight off after you have lost it
